Abstract / Description

In the fledgling field of Digital Religion much deliberation has been given to how technology and digital culture has impacted on religion. Less attention however, has been in the other direction, namely how religion itself might have influenced technology and the internet. Here, Jon Baldwin considers Tim Berners-Lee, Unitarianism, and the internet.
